Exposure to ammonia gas causes severe tissue damage to skin, lungs, and eyes. Toxic effects, both immediate and delayed, can alter the response to other injuries. We report a 14-year-old boy who suffered multiple trauma in a vehicular accident and at the same time was exposed to anhydrous ammonia. He exhibited severe pulmonary and ocular damage in addition to other severe injuries, and despite aggressive treatment, died of respiratory failure.
